Which step ensures that the message is effectively communicated to the audience?

The step that ensures the message is effectively communicated to the audience is the execution phase. During this phase, the plan and preparations made prior come together, and the message is delivered in the intended manner. Effective execution involves clear articulation, appropriate body language, and an understanding of the audience’s responses. This stage also requires adaptability, as the communicator may need to adjust the delivery based on real-time feedback or engagement with the audience.

Planning and preparation are crucial components that set the foundation for effective communication, but it is through execution that the message is actually conveyed to the audience. Assessment, while important for evaluating the effectiveness of communication after the fact, does not directly impact the immediate delivery of the message. Hence, execution is the critical step that transforms ideas and strategies into a tangible message that resonates with the audience.
